0:54.9 | Today I'm talking about how to stop believing everything that you think. Your brain is an amazing storyteller and it likes to play tricks on you. |
1:01.0 | And much of the time, the stories it creates and the things it tells you aren't true. |
1:06.5 | It will look at all the things that have happened to you in the past and turn it into a story. |
1:10.7 | Like it might tell you that you're not smart enough by weaving together all the mistakes you've made |
1:15.2 | and reminding you of every failure that you've ever had. |
1:19.2 | Your brain will also try to convince you that it has amazing fortune-telling capabilities. |
1:24.5 | As you think about the future, it will make predictions about what might happen |
1:28.4 | and try to convince you that it knows how things are going to end. In the moment, it will also try to |
1:34.4 | convince you that you're incompetent or that no one likes you. It will try to trick you into acting |
1:40.1 | in a way that makes those things become true. The conversations that you have with yourself are powerful. |
1:46.6 | Your self-talk affects how you feel and how you behave. |
1:50.6 | Like if you're thinking that you're going to fail at something, |
1:53.3 | you'll probably feel nervous or discouraged. |
1:56.0 | And then you might put in less effort |
1:57.7 | because you assume that you're going to fail |
1:59.5 | regardless of how hard you try. That will actually increase the chances that you're going to fail. Or if you walk into a new |
2:06.6 | situation thinking that you don't belong or that you don't fit in, you'll probably go sit by yourself |
2:12.0 | in the corner because you feel awkward. Then people will be less likely to talk to you and you'll |
